Quotes by Tsunetomo Yamamoto, Hagakure: The Book of the Samurai

"In the Kamigata area, they have a sort of tiered lunchbox they use for a single day when flower viewing. Upon returning, they throw them away, trampling them underfoot. The end is important in all things."
"Bushido is realized in the presence of death. This means choosing death whenever there is a choice between life and death. There is no other reasoning."
